Competición UNRobot simulación 👉 Inscríbete
Este repositorio contiene el código base necesario para participar en los retos de simulación del UN robot tanto intermedio como avanzado. estos retos consisten en desarrollar algoritmos de posicionamiento y localización utilizando el entorno de simulación de Robotics Playground.
Una vez configurado el Ambiente de programación la forma de iniciar la simulación es sencilla solo hay que correr el archivo setup.m dentro de MATLAB. Para editar el modelo escoge el archivo UNrobot_pro.slx o UNrobot_intermediate.slx Estos son los únicos archivos que requieres para desarrollar tu solución.
Los demás archivos contienen versiones modificadas de archivos de robotics playground por lo que debes mantenerlos dentro de la carpeta donde desarrolles tu solución no es recomendable que añadas este directorio a el PATH de MATLAB ya que puede generar incompatibilidades al momento de usar el robotics playground.
Es un robot diferencial equipado con encoder en las ruedas sensores de proximidad, giroscopio, magnetómetro.
El ambiente se divide en 2 secciones: el lado derecho donde los obstáculos permanecerán inalterados y el lado izquierdo demarcado como Uncharted Area donde se incorporarán obstáculos de tamaños arbitrarios y en posiciones no especificadas.
Para la de este proyecto se requiere una instalación de:
- Matlab (versión recomendada 2021a)
- Entorno de programación simulink incluyendo las
- bibliotecas de simscape Mechanics y simscape Electronics
- Toolbox robotics playground